Amplifier is suitable for cable set top boxes, cable modems, xDSL modems and xDSL central office line cards. The ADA4938-2 is a low noise, ultralow distortion, high speed differential amplifier.

It is an ideal choice for driving high performance ADCs with resolutions up to 16 bits from dc to 27 MHz, or up to 12 bits from dc to 74 MHz. The output common-mode voltage is adjustable over a wide range, allowing the ADA4938-2 to match the input of the ADC.

Full differential and single-ended-to-differential gain configurations are easily realized with the ADA4938-2. A simple external feedback network of four resistors determines the closed-loop gain of the amplifier.

The ADA4938-2 is fabricated using the proprietary third-generation, high voltage XFCB process, enabling it to achieve very low levels of distortion with an input voltage noise. The low dc offset and excellent dynamic performance of the ADA4938-2 make it well suited for a wide variety of data acquisition and signal processing applications.

  • Extremely low harmonic distortion
  • High speed
  • Fast overdrive recovery of 4 ns
  • Low input voltage noise
  • Externally adjustable gain
  • Differential-to-differential or single-ended-to-differential operation
  • Adjustable output common-mode voltage
  • Applications:
    • ADC drivers
    • Single-ended-to-differential converters
    • IF and baseband gain blocks
    • Differential buffers
    • Line drivers
